Bean to Cup Machines

There's nothing better than a freshly made cup of coffee made from whole beans. Bean to cup machines are an economical alternative to coffee shops with the added convenience of being easy to use and producing consistent quality.

These hands-off automatic machines grind the beans, heat the water and brew your beverage at the push of one button. They don't use single-use materials such as filters or plastic pods, unlike pod and sachet machines.

Freshness

When freshly ground beans are brewed, the flavor and aroma is much more intense than instant coffee. Bean-to cup machines grind the coffee beans just before brewing to ensure that the coffee is fresh as is possible. Contrary to pre-ground beans that lose flavor quickly due to exposure to oxygen, bean-to cup machines grind beans just as they are needed in order to preserve the intensity and fullness of the flavour.

In the end, bean-to-cup machines make the most delicious high-quality cup of coffee that is available anywhere. Bean to cup machines also offer a wide range of beverages such as cappuccino, espresso, latte and cafe creme - allowing businesses to cater to all preferences for coffee.

For those who have a particular taste for something sweet the bean to cup machines typically include the option of adding an option to dispensing hot chocolate. This is a great way to offer customers or employees some sweet treats, along with your freshly brewed coffee.

Maintenance

Based on the model, bean-to-cup machines generally require minimal maintenance. The majority of them include built-in cleaning and descaling programmes that are activated by a warning light, or at the time of each use. Consult your manufacturer for the recommended cleaning schedule. This will ensure the machine is running efficiently and will continue to produce excellent coffee for many the years to come.

If your commercial bean-to- cup coffee machine has an integrated milk texturizing device, it will serve cold or hot milk, based on the drink you've selected. Ensure this system is cleaned immediately after each use to avoid the milk deposits from hardening and clogging the machine. Also, you should regularly clean the drip tray and bean hopper, as well as exterior surfaces to remove residue.
